SBA網路架構
服務化架構(SBA: Service-based architecture)是5G網路的基礎架構。SBA的本質是按照“自包含、可重用、獨立管理”三原則,將網路功能定義為若干個可被靈活調用的“服務”模組。基於此,運營商可以按照業務需求進行靈活定製組網。
SBA網路架構具備三大特徵:
1、松耦合的微服務
2、輕量高效的服務調用接口
3、自動化、智慧型化的服務管理框架
SBA中,網路功能間的互動由“服務調用實現,每個網路功能對外呈現通用的服務化接口,可被授權的網路功能或服務調用。而傳統2G、3G、4G網路架構採用的是“點對點”的架構,網元和網元之間的接口需預先定義和配置,且定義的接口只能用於特定的兩類網元間使用,靈活性不強。
3GPP是全球移動通信系統產業技術的標準制定組織,從2G到4G的標準都由其制定 。2017年5月 3GPP SA2的第121次會上,由中國移動牽頭並聯合26家公司確定了SBA作為5G的基礎架構。
SBA接口
3GPP 在Release 15選定了SBA接口的協定實現組合:TCP、HTTP/2、JSON、Restful、OpenAPI 3.0。這種協定設計帶來諸多優點:便於採用新的網際網路技術、實現快速部署、面向連續的集成和發布新的網路服務、便於運營商自有或第三方業務開發。
SBA的協定將持續最佳化,如HTTP/2 承載於IETF QUIC/UDP、採用二進制編碼方法(如CBOR)等是後續演進的可能的技術方向。
SBA對運營商的價值
敏捷:服務松耦合,網路部署、維護、升級更快速、便利
易擴展:輕量級的接口使得新功能的引入不需要引入新的接口設計
靈活:通過模組化、可重用方式實現網路功能的組合,滿足網路切片等靈活組網需求
開放:新型REST API接口極大的便於運營商或第三方調用服務